The Honda CG xxx Cargo is a model I would like to have.
"Pizza delivery bike"
If you ride solo. Why have a seat for 2.
And not a solo seat and a luggage rack direct behind the solo seat. And not behind the bike.
Mounted at the factory.. Ready for 20 kg.
Now the Cargo exists in a 160 cc version
15 Hp
121 kg
(I have seen that they use the Honda PCX 125 here. As Pizza delivery bike.
But it is not my taste)
Simon Gandolfi used a 125 cc Cargo.
